One of our clients at I and D Insurance Services, Frances Fleming, recently approached me to see if I could help the Charity she co-founded with Alistair Gibb to help a young lad called Trust from the Matsetso village in the Chimanimani region of Zimbabwe, Africa.
He is a promising young golfer whom they already support and assist with food. Following on from the success of my Club Hire Scheme, where Strathmore members, friends and other golfers have donated amazing amounts of equipment, I had no hesitation in offering help.
Today I presented a full set of King Cobra clubs and squeezed in another set of Wilson Fat Shafts into a carry bag which is being taken to Trust by a friend of Frances who is across for The Open. I have asked Trust to keep me updated with his progress so look forward to him catching up.
The charity was set up to help disadvantaged young people and it has already helped with football equipment, strips and boots. They also support six children, allowing them to attend school.
Alistair sponsors Zander who is just about to finish an Electrical Engineering course at College. The funding raised by this Charity goes a long way in the education of the youngsters and their understanding in preserving their unique environment.
